[chore] a2a-routes: authenticate send_message responder + gate cancel task (PM-only) (#116 #423)

send_message took the responder identity from a client-supplied
metadata.from_agent, so any caller could spoof anyone (e.g.
from_agent='ceo') in the task's notes and in the spawn/notification
routed back to the original requester. Stamp the authenticated caller's
slug as the responder instead (CurrentAgentContext).

cancel_task was ungated: no auth dependency and no role check, so any
agent (or any caller) could cancel a task the lifecycle rule reserves to
PM roles (Any -> cancelled: PM roles only) — and the cascade-cancel of
all non-terminal descendants ran with a hardcoded cell_pm role and no
recorded actor. Add require_any_authenticated_agent + a PM-or-above gate,
and thread the authenticated role (into the cascade role gate) and slug
(into the cancellation note) into A2AService.cancel_task.

Tests: send_message ignores a spoofed from_agent and records the
authenticated slug; cancel rejects a developer (403) and a missing auth
header; a PM cancel threads role + slug into the service; the pre-existing
cancel success/already-terminal/not-found tests now run under a PM context
(the success test's body was missing the A2A 'name' field and false-passed
on a 422 — now genuine).
